The cheapest way to get from Wimereux to Ghent is to drive which costs €27 - €40 and takes 1h 47m.
The fastest way to get from Wimereux to Ghent is to drive which takes 1h 47m and costs €27 - €40.
No, there is no direct train from Wimereux to Ghent. However, there are services departing from Wimille Wimereux and arriving at Gand-Saint-Pierre via Calais Frethun, Lille Europe and Bruxelles-Midi.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 12m.
The distance between Wimereux and Ghent is 286 km. The road distance is 174.9 km.
The best way to get from Wimereux to Ghent without a car is to train via Brussels which takes 3h 12m and costs €45 - €150.
It takes approximately 3h 12m to get from Wimereux to Ghent, including transfers.
Wimereux to Ghent train services, operated by Société Nationale des Chemins de fer Français (SNCF), depart from Calais Frethun station.
Wimereux to Ghent train services, operated by Société Nationale des Chemins de fer Français (SNCF), arrive at Lille Europe station.
Yes, the driving distance between Wimereux to Ghent is 175 km. It takes approximately 1h 47m to drive from Wimereux to Ghent.
